Under the Hood: AI and Smart Tech in Action
The heart of the Luba 3’s innovation lies in its AI and smart navigation system. Here’s how it works:
- Wire-Free Navigation: Uses GPS and RTK for centimeter-level precision, eliminating the need for boundary wires. This is a significant advantage over competitors like the Husqvarna Automower NERA, which still relies on virtual boundaries.
- AI-Powered Obstacle Detection: The mower’s vision system identifies and avoids obstacles—from garden hoses to pet toys—without getting stuck or damaging them.
- Dynamic Mowing Patterns: Unlike traditional robot lawn mowers that follow fixed paths, the Luba 3 adjusts its mowing pattern based on your lawn’s unique shape and obstacles, ensuring even coverage.
- Multi-Zone Support: Ideal for homeowners with complex yards, the Luba 3 can manage up to 10 different zones, mowing each according to its specific needs.
- All-Terrain Capability: Handles slopes up to 20 degrees and can tackle rough or uneven terrain, making it versatile for a variety of landscapes.
This level of intelligence sets the Luba 3 apart from many robotic mowers that rely on simpler, wire-based systems. It’s a step toward truly autonomous yard care, where the mower does the thinking for you.
Performance: Does It Deliver on the Promise?
In real-world testing, the Mammotion Luba 3 proves to be a capable and efficient autonomous lawn mower. Its AI-driven navigation works impressively well, even in yards with tight spaces, slopes, and multiple obstacles. The mower’s ability to create a digital map of your lawn and adjust its path dynamically means fewer missed spots and a more consistent cut.
The cutting performance is on par with top-tier robot lawn mowers. The Luba 3 features a floating blade system that adapts to the terrain, ensuring a clean, even cut regardless of surface irregularities. It also offers adjustable cutting heights (from 1.6 to 3.5 inches), catering to different grass types and seasonal needs.
Battery life is another strong suit. The Luba 3 is equipped with a high-capacity lithium-ion battery that allows for extended runtime—enough to cover up to 1.25 acres on a single charge. When the battery runs low, the mower automatically returns to its docking station to recharge, then resumes mowing where it left off. This seamless operation is a hallmark of advanced smart mowing systems.
That said, no robotic mower is perfect. The Luba 3’s initial mapping process can take some time, especially for larger or more complex yards. Additionally, while the obstacle detection is impressive, it’s not infallible—users should still clear their lawn of small, hard-to-detect objects to avoid potential issues.
How It Stacks Up Against the Competition
The robot lawn mower market is becoming increasingly crowded, with options ranging from budget-friendly models like the Worx Landroid to high-end offerings like the Husqvarna Automower 450X. So, where does the Mammotion Luba 3 fit in?
vs. Husqvarna Automower 450X: The Automower 450X is a top-tier autonomous lawn mower with excellent cutting performance and smart features. However, it still relies on boundary wires for navigation, which can be a drawback for users seeking a wire-free experience. The Luba 3’s AI-driven system offers more flexibility in this regard.
vs. Worx Landroid M: The Landroid M is a solid mid-range option with a focus on affordability and ease of use. While it lacks the advanced AI and wire-free navigation of the Luba 3, it’s a great choice for homeowners with simpler lawns who want a reliable, no-frills robotic mower.
vs. Mammotion Luba 2: For those familiar with Mammotion’s previous model, the Luba 3 is a significant upgrade. It improves upon the Luba 2 with enhanced AI, better obstacle detection, and a more robust build. If you’re already a Mammotion fan, the Luba 3 is a worthy successor.
The Luba 3’s wire-free design and AI capabilities make it a standout in the smart mowing space, particularly for tech-savvy users and professionals who need a high degree of customization and control.
